How to find the slope?

The letter m is usually used to refer to the slope. To calculate it, we divide the change in y over the change in x.

[tex]m=\frac{y_{2}-y_{1}}{x_{2}-x_{1}}[/tex]

In order to find this, we must find at least 2 coordinates that we know the function passes through.

In this case, we can see that the function passes through the point (3,0) and (0,-2).

[tex]m=\frac{0-(-2)}{3-0} = \frac{2}{3}[/tex]

Now that we know that the slope is [tex]\frac{2}{3}[/tex] we can ignore options C and D since [tex]\frac{3}{2} \neq \frac{2}{3}[/tex]

What is the y-intercept?

The y-intercept is the y value were the function touches the y axis.

In this case, we can see that the only point where the function touches the y axis (the vertical one) is -2
